This is a vibrant little coffee shop on a downtown corner of Long Beach. The breakfast foods are great and the coffee is even better. I got the breakfast burrito that appears to have come fresh off the panini press and it was a delight. I followed that up with one of their spring, seasonal drinks, the cherry blossom cloud brew. The foam was delectable and their cold brew coffee was strong but not bitter, a perfect cup

I found this place on Yelp and was so excited to try! I seem good reviews here and on TikTok. My sister and I finally got around to trying it. It's a quaint coffee shop in the heart of downtown Long Beach. I was lucky to find street parking. Upon arrival, I wasn't impressed or disappointed. Everything was pretty standard. They had a regular menu and limited time or seasonal menu. The service was sub par. Kind of dry but they were kinda busy. I ordered two drinks, the smores and brown butter or sugar one. The smores had more flavor (I asked for extra sweet on both) the browned butter one was nothing spectacular. They were smooth but didn't have a strong coffee profile. I don't think it was good enough to go back but I can see why the locals enjoy it.

I don't know what people are writing about when they say rude service... I think they must have been the rude ones and not the people working there. The staff were very friendly and even checked on me after I started eating. The lady taking my order said she makes the vanilla syrup for the cloud coffee herself and they have single origin beans so the coffee is strong and tasty. The breakfast burrito was delicious and was pressed so it stayed intact and didn't fall apart as I was eating it. They have cute cafe tables outside that are perfect if you bring your furry friend.

Elijah T.

I came in for their Winter Series! I ordered their Matcha Grinch Latte drink (not sure if that was the name since it was handwritten and not on the printed out menu.) My friend got the campfire latte, and while I don't drink coffee, I can confidently say that this place does not serve good matcha. It tasted closer to chocolate milk than actual matcha. I'm sure they have better drinks, but for anyone else, stay away from the matcha if you want to save your 7 dollars. Parking is limited but the interior more than makes up for the drinks, it's got outlets, and plenty of tables for college students, but I can see it being busy during finals.

Karen D.

First time here and I came for the biscoff butter latte. It's cute and bright inside with plenty of outside seating. The bakery items were stand outs. The ham n cheese croissant was super flaky and well made. The biscuit for the breakfast sando was delicious, the jam on the side was perfect with it. Now for the biscoff latte, I'm not sure if it was the oat milk or the butter but the drink tasted nutty, it was alright. The staff was very friendly
